Probe launched after jet carrying Libyan military officials crashes in Turkiye

[The Africa news - Africa] - 27/12/2025
Ankara [Turkiye], December 27 (ANI): Turkish and Libyan authorities have opened a joint probe into the crash of a private jet near Ankara that claimed the lives of Libya's army chief, Mohammed Ali Ahmed al-Haddad and seven others, Al Jazeera reported.
